Overview Panlong 40mg Tablet
Gastric acid production is lowered by the 40mg Panlong Tablet, a medication effective in treating stomach and intestinal disorders linked to excess acid. These include heartburn, acid reflux, peptic ulcers, and Zollinger-Ellison syndrome, offering both symptom relief and healing support. Panlong 40mg also prevents stomach ulcers and hyperacidity often associated with prolonged n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ID) use. Classified as a proton pump inhibitor (PPI), it's best taken one hour before meals, ideally in the morning. Dosage is tailored to individual needs and response. Continue treatment as prescribed, even with rapid symptom improvement. Smaller, more frequent meals, and avoidance of caffeine (tea, coffee), spicy, and fatty foods can enhance treatment effectiveness. Common, typically mild side effects include nausea, vomiting, headache, dizziness, gas, diarrhea, and stomach ache. Persistent or bothersome side effects warrant medical attention. Prolonged use, particularly exceeding one year, may raise the risk of bone fractures, especially at higher doses. Discuss bone loss (osteoporosis) prevention strategies, such as calcium and vitamin D supplementation, with your physician. Prior to commencing treatment, inform your doctor of severe liver disease, HIV medication use, prior allergic reactions to similar drugs, or pre-existing osteoporosis. Pregnant or breastfeeding individuals should seek medical advice before use.

How Panlong 40mg Tablet works:
Each Panlong 40mg tablet contains a proton pump inhibitor that lessens stomach acid production, thus providing relief from heartburn and indigestion caused by excess acidity.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holUNSAFE
Alcohol consumption alongside Panlong 40mg Tablet is inadvisable.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Use of Panlong 40mg tablets during pregnancy may pose risks. While human data is scarce, animal research indicates potential harm to the fetus. A physician will assess the benefits against potential risks prior to prescription. Seek medical advice.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Lactation and the use of Panlong 40mg tablets appear compatible. Available human data indicate minimal infant risk associated with this medication.
DrivingUNSAFE
Driving ability may be impaired by side effects associated with Panlong 40mg tablets.
KidneyS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Panlong 40mg tablets pose no safety concerns for patients with kidney impairment; no dosage modification is necessary.
LiverCAUTION
Individuals with severe hepatic impairment should exercise caution when using Panlong 40mg tablets. Dosage modification of Panlong 40mg tablets may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
What if you forget to take Panlong 40mg Tablet :
Should you forget a Panlong 40mg Tablet dose, take it immediately.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ual medication routine. Never take a double dose.
